What you'll be doing

Under the general direction of the nurse manager for the ambulatory care unit the registered nurse is responsible for professional nursing care and related assistance to adolescent, adult and geriatric patients admitted. The registered nurse utilizes the nursing process in ensuring safe and competent quality patient care. The registered nurse supports the medical care of patients under the direction of the medical staff pursuant to the mission and objectives of the hospital. The registered nurse provides leadership by working cooperatively with ancillary nursing and other patient care team personnel in maintaining standards for professional nursing practice in the clinical setting. The registered nurse provides direction to licensed vocational nurses and unlicensed assistive personnel in providing patient care. The registered nurse must be able to assess own learning needs to enhance personal and professional development. The nurse will increase knowledge and skills related to patient care by attending workshops, formal classes, and seminars and in services.

What your background should be

Current Texas license with state board of nurse examiners. Current CPR certification. ACLS/CNOR/PALS/TNCC preferred.

Required Schooling / Training

Graduate of an accredited school of nursing.
